Output 85a43764a33072f389f7134c6bf8df2c775e06253e25692d77dff2407373e961:82

value
1415868
script pubkey
OP_0 OP_PUSHBYTES_32 c9e2911e3663cc4eb0b60da61b1a4306d2f9621a63f436ee9ae5cddb6acbbc79
address
bc1qe83fz83kv0xyav9kpknpkxjrqmf0jcs6v06rdm56uhxak6kth3us6x25sy
transaction
85a43764a33072f389f7134c6bf8df2c775e06253e25692d77dff2407373e961
spent
true